  • Fischer, Texas Census Data
  • The total number of people in Fischer is 310. Of those, 159 are Male (51.29 %) and 151 are Female (48.71 %).

    In Fischer, Texas 40.6 is the median age.

    Fischer, Texas population is broken down (as a percentage) by age as follows:

    Under Age of 5: 5.81 %
    Ages 5 to 9: 6.13 %
    Ages 10 to 14: 10.32 %
    Ages 15 to 19: 3.87 %
    Ages 20 to 24: 4.84 %
    Ages 25 to 34: 8.06 %
    Ages 35 to 44: 18.71 %
    Ages 45 to 54: 19.35 %
    Ages 55 to 59: 5.16 %
    Ages 60 to 64: 6.77 %
    Ages 65 to 74: 6.13 %
    Ages 75 to 84: 4.84 %
    Over the age of 85: 0.00 %

    Fischer Statistical Data
    Fischer, Texas Total Area covers 10.56 Square Miles.
    Total Water Area is 0.02 Square Miles.
    Total Land Area is 10.54 Square Miles.
    In Fischer, TX. pop. density is 29.41 persons/square mile.
    Fischer, Texas is located in the Central (GMT -6) Time Zone.
    The elevation in Fischer is 623 Ft.

Fischer, Texas drug and alcohol rehab facilities ordinarily start out the treatment process with drug and/or alcohol detoxification. Drug or alcohol withdrawal symptoms can range from anxiousness, depression, insomnia, arthralgia (joint pain), achy muscles, seizures and other withdrawal symptoms depending on the severity of the addiction and the variety of drug that the person has been addicted to and length of time they have been using. This is why it is vital that the detoxification is medically supervised by a state-licensed drug treatment and alcohol rehab center or hospital. Detoxification is accomplished as a result of a variety of treatment methods to relieve the physical dependence of drugs or alcohol which can take from 3 to 10 days.

If you or your loved one in Fischer, Texas has a severe drug or alcohol abuse problem, an in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ation program would be the most effective option usually. Serious drug and alcohol addiction usually brings about the following behaviors: dishonesty, thieving, withdrawal from friends and family, difficulties on the job or no job at all, emotional instability etc. These irrational behaviors are commonly present in the case of a serious drug and alcohol addiction issue. When there is a serious addiction present it can incredibly difficult if not impossible to stop without the help from a professional inpatient drug treatment and alcohol rehab programs.

Out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ers are offered for men and women with moderate alcohol or drug abuse problems. An outpatient drug treatment and alcohol rehabilitation facility is a better choice for those individuals who have recently started abusing drugs or alcohol and they have not yet formed a dependence upon the substance yet their drug or alcohol use is turning into an issue that they do need help with before it does get out of control. Outpatient drug rehab and alcohol rehabilitation centers have quite limited supervision as opposed to an inpatient or residential program, which normally takes place under 24-hour supervision. It is important that drug testing is available in an outpatient program as a deterrent to the person using drugs or alcohol while participating with outpatient drug or alcohol treatment.
